After several months of rapid development, the ecosystem of the chain abstraction leader ZetaChain has been initially formed. At the beginning of this year, it further upgraded its narrative to become the industry's first universal blockchain. Currently, the types and number of applications that can be experienced by users on ZetaChain are very rich, especially ZetaChain supports the direct cross-chain transfer of Bitcoin to ZetaChain and participation in DeFi projects, which will largely release the potential value of Bitcoin, the largest Crypto asset.

Currently, ZetaChain supports Bitcoin, Ethereum, BNB Chain, Polygon, Base and Solana. Sui and Ton have also been implemented on the testnet. Amana

Amana is a DeFi yield aggregator. Users can deposit assets into the Vault set up by Amana. Amana will look for high-yield DeFi protocols on the chain linked to ZetaChain, and deposit the assets across chains into the corresponding protocols through ZetaChain's Omnichain protocol. Currently, users can earn points by depositing at least 50 USDT or USDC into the Vault.

Pitch Lucy

Pitch Lucy is an AI investment game. Lucy is a virtual character generated by AI. Users need to pay a certain fee to pitch a token they like to Lucy, and AI will decide whether to buy the token. If AI decides not to buy the token, the fee paid by the user will be concentrated on ZetaChain through the gateway; if a user successfully convinces Lucy to buy the token she recommends, AI will cross-chain the funds in the fee pool previously concentrated on ZetaChain to the chain where the target asset is located and purchase it through DEX.

Currently, users can get points rewards by pitching tokens on ZetaChain to Lucy at least once.

Accumulated Finance

Accumulated Finance is an Omnichain liquid staking protocol. Users can obtain stZETA by staking ZETA. However, the liquidity staking token stZETA launched by Accumulated Finance and the stZETA launched by ZetaEarn have the same name but different token contracts. If users want to stake ZETA and use stZETA to obtain additional income in DeFi, they need to check the stZETA token contracts supported by different DeFi protocols in advance.

As of the time of writing, the amount of ZETA staked through Accumulated Finance exceeds 210,000.

Stake n' Bake

Stake n' Bake aims to launch a full-chain NFT game through ZetaChain's full-chain interoperability, allowing players to play the game without switching wallets or switching networks.

There are three roles in Stake n'Bake: informants, farmers, and narcotics police. Farmers can earn income by staking tokens, which is displayed as "growing marijuana" in the game. Narcotics police can "raid" farmers who have pledged tokens and have a certain probability of success, thereby confiscating the farmers' tokens. Informants may become narcotics informants or drug addicts. Becoming a narcotics informant will increase the success rate of narcotics police raids, while becoming a drug addict will increase the farmer's yield.

The game's developers said that in many jurisdictions, the cultivation and consumption of marijuana remains a controversial topic, and they hope to use the game to satirize some of the contradictions among various parties on this issue.
